From streets to trackside thrills: Yamaha riders feel the ultimate rush in Gurugram
India Yamaha Motor brings its Call of the Blue Track Day to F9 Go-Karting, Gurugram, giving over 200 R15 and MT-15 owners a safe, instructor-led introduction to real track riding and racing techniques.

Yamaha MT-15 Price Increased in India by Up to Rs. 800
Yamaha has raised the price of the MT-15 in India by Rs 740 to Rs 800. The motorcycle retains its 155cc engine, standard features, and variant options, with no mechanical updates following the price increase.

Bajaj Pulsar N160 Gets Premium Golden USD Forks And Single-Seat Comfort In New Variant
The Bajaj Pulsar N160 gets a bold upgrade with gold USD forks for superior handling and a single-seat setup for daily comfort, priced at Rs 1,23,983. Available in Pearl Metallic White, Racing Red, Polar Sky Blue, and Black.​
